you will get a 12 month ban with the choice to do a drink driving awareness course which will knock off 3 months on the ban so 9 months . i was banned when i was just over the limit in the morning 6 years ago. i had a S3 before my b5 rs4 which was`nt too bad for insurance but when i first got my rs4 with 3 years no claims and a DR10 my insurance was £3500 for the year but dropped by half that the next year . if you get a lawyer you might be LUCKY and just get a 6 month ban . as it was only 41 you wont get more then a 12 month ban . good luck mate
